Unfair Trade Practice

  

If you’re a business that wants to stay in business, best stay away from unfair trade practices.

Unfair trade practices are illegal via Consumer Protection Law in the U.S. Unfair trade practice is a term that covers a whole slew of unethical business practices, to the detriment of consumers: false advertising, fake raffles, deceptive pricing (looking at you, Overstock), and skirting around manufacturing and safety standards. Or any standards, really.

Insurance companies, landlords, and lenders are all subject to getting in trouble with Consumer Protection Law too via unfair trade practices...any deception in the marketplace is game for a class action lawsuit. You. Don't. Want. This.
